GNU/Linux >> Tutoriels Linux >  >> Cent OS

Comment installer Ntopng sur CentOS 7

Dans ce tutoriel, nous allons vous montrer comment installer Ntopng sur CentOS 7. Pour ceux d'entre vous qui ne le savaient pas, Ntopng est un outil relativement utile si vous cherchez à surveiller différents réseaux protocoles sur vos serveurs. Il fournit un ensemble d'outils pour surveiller divers protocoles, des variantes de trafic et, oui, la bande passante sur plusieurs périodes. Ntopng est basé sur libpcap et il a été écrit de manière portable afin de fonctionner virtuellement sur chaque Unix plate-forme, macOS et sur Win32 également.

Cet article suppose que vous avez au moins des connaissances de base sur Linux, que vous savez utiliser le shell et, plus important encore, que vous hébergez votre site sur votre propre VPS. L'installation est assez simple. Je vais vous montrer l'installation étape par étape de Ntopng sur CentOS 7.

Prérequis

  • Un serveur exécutant l'un des systèmes d'exploitation suivants :CentOS 7.
  • Il est recommandé d'utiliser une nouvelle installation du système d'exploitation pour éviter tout problème potentiel.
  • Accès SSH au serveur (ou ouvrez simplement Terminal si vous êtes sur un ordinateur).
  • Un non-root sudo user ou l'accès à l'root user . Nous vous recommandons d'agir en tant qu'non-root sudo user , cependant, car vous pouvez endommager votre système si vous ne faites pas attention lorsque vous agissez en tant que root.

Installer Ntopng sur CentOS 7

Étape 1. Tout d'abord, nous devons ajouter le référentiel EPEL à notre système.

yum install epel-release wget

Étape 2. Créez le référentiel Ntop pour les versions stables.

# cat /etc/yum.repos.d/ntop.repo
[ntop]
name=ntop packages
baseurl=http://www.nmon.net/centos-stable/$releasever/$basearch/
enabled=1
gpgcheck=1
gpgkey=http://www.nmon.net/centos-stable/RPM-GPG-KEY-deri
[ntop-noarch]
name=ntop packages
baseurl=http://www.nmon.net/centos-stable/$releasever/noarch/
enabled=1
gpgcheck=1
gpgkey=http://www.nmon.net/centos-stable/RPM-GPG-KEY-deri

Étape 3. Installez les packages Ntopng sur CentOS 7.

yum update
yum install ntopng ntopng-data
yum install redis php-pecl-redis

Étape 4. Configurez Ntopng.

Une fois installé, Ntopng a besoin d'un fichier de configuration. À des fins de test, nous pouvons utiliser l'exemple de fichier de configuration, mais n'oubliez pas de créer un fichier de configuration approprié (man Ntopng) plus tard :

cp /etc/ntopng/ntopng.conf.sample /etc/ntopng/ntopng.conf

Étape 5. Démarrez Ntopng et le serveur Redis permet également au service de démarrer au démarrage :

systemctl start redis-server.service
systemctl enable redis-server.service
systemctl start ntopng.service
systemctl enable ntopng.service

Étape 6. Configurez ipables ou pare-feu.

firewall-cmd --direct --add-rule ipv4 filter IN_public_allow 0 -m tcp -p tcp --dport 3000 -s 192.168.1.146 -j ACCEPT

Étape 7. Accédez à Ntopng.

Si tout va bien, vous pouvez maintenant tester votre application Ntopng en tapant http://your-server-ip:3000 . Vous verrez la page de connexion Ntopng. Pour la première fois, vous pouvez utiliser l'utilisateur "admin" et le mot de passe "admin".

Félicitations ! Vous avez installé Ntopng avec succès. Merci d'avoir utilisé ce didacticiel pour installer la surveillance du serveur Ntopng sur les systèmes CentOS 7. Pour obtenir de l'aide supplémentaire ou des informations utiles, nous vous recommandons de consulter le site Web officiel de Ntopng.


Cent OS
  1. Comment installer PHP 7, 7.2 et 7.3 sur CentOS 7

  2. Comment installer Java 11 et 12 sur CentOS 7

  3. Comment installer Wine 4.0 sur CentOS 7

  4. Comment installer Vim 8.2 sur CentOS 7

  5. Comment installer Ntopng sur CentOS 6

Comment installer Java sur CentOS 7

Comment installer Ruby sur CentOS 7

Comment installer PostgreSQL sur CentOS 7

Comment installer Go sur CentOS 7

Comment installer R sur CentOS 7

Comment installer R sur CentOS 8